    Started watching this only because I read the book series when it first came out...and the reason I got the book series was because I wanted to see what kind of new spin Guillermo Del Toro could put on the vampire legend....plus a lot of it takes place in N.Y State....I have to admit though - overall I wasn't thrilled with the books...I thought I thought they were just 'okay'...could've been better.

    I figured, with Del Toro involved, it was probably always part of the plan to be a film or cable show, so maybe that will be better than the book version.
    So far I like it. It's a little hammy, but the effects and makeup have been handled well. I don't much care for the actor chosen to play the lead...but that hardly matters because in the show, as with the books, the secondary characters are far more interesting anyway. Fet - the exterminator is totally cool.
